Join our team as a Systems Analyst, where you'll provide essential technical support for diverse projects and data challenges. Your role will involve maintaining and creating PowerBI projects, automating data extraction, and offering support for proprietary database queries and ad hoc reporting. Proficiency in data analysis, business intelligence, data science, programming (SQL and Python), and cloud technologies (especially AWS S3) will be essential in driving success in this position.
Bachelor's degree in a relevant field (e.g., Computer Science, Data Science, Business Analytics)
Minimum three years of experience in data modeling and data visualizations
Proficiency in data analysis, data modeling, and data visualization is required, utilizing tools like PowerBI, Dash Plotly, Tableau, and Excel.
Experience with cloud-based data management technologies, especially AWS S3, is necessary to leverage the scalability and efficiency of cloud computing.
Be able to develop and maintain data pipelines, manage data warehousing, and execute ETL processes using technologies such as Redshift AWS, AWS Glue, SSRS, and SSAS.
Proficiency in SQL and Python is expected for data manipulation and analysis
Ability to communicate ideas and information verbally, both one-on-one and in meetings, in a manner that is clear and concise. Presents prepared information in a manner that holds customers' interest and addresses their needs and concerns. Able to adjust presentation styles to correspond to the audience being addressed.
Ability to present written information in a clear, concise and organized manner. Writes technical information so that it can be understood by non-technical audiences.
Ability to manage own time, activities & resources. Identifies work activities needed to accomplish objectives & coordinates those activities to deliver desired results. Prioritizes multiple activities & projects.
Ability to gather and analyze facts and data and to draw correct inferences from the information.
Excellent written and verbal communication skills.
Ability to make practical, timely and realistic decisions after considering possible outcomes as well as corresponding risks.
Work beyond a normal 40 hour week may be required to meet project deadlines.
#LI-DV1
Leverage experience with cloud-based data management technologies, particularly AWS S3, to ensure scalability and efficiency in data operations.
Collaborate with the IT team to design and implement cloud-based data solutions that align with organizational objectives.
Leverage experience with cloud-based data management technologies, particularly AWS S3, to ensure scalability and efficiency in data operations.
Develop and maintain robust data pipelines to ensure efficient data extraction, transformation, and loading (ETL) processes.
Manage data warehousing solutions to support the organization's data needs, potentially using Redshift AWS.
Execute ETL processes using technologies like AWS Glue, SSRS (SQL Server Analysis Services).
Recommends improvements to existing technologies & methods, to improve the quality/timeliness of technical & customer support.
Delivers quality and timely results, i.e., technical and customer support, based on company business needs and objectives.
Recommends and implements improvements to existing technologies and methods or proposes new ones, to improve the quality and timeliness of technical and customer support.
Delivers quality & timely results, i.e., technical and customer support, based on company business needs and objectives.
Maintains state-of-the-art knowledge within areas of responsibility.
Fosters the development of technical knowledge and performance skills of technicians.
Complies with and supports all corporate, department and unit policies and procedures.
Keeps manager, project teams & business unit customers informed of activities & problems within assigned areas of responsibility; refers matters beyond limits of authority to manager for direction.
Presents technology capabilities to internal and external parties as needed.
Provides technology demonstrations for sales/prospect meetings as needed.
Support operations as needed at prospect meetings during implementation and post go live.
Tracks, monitors and updates senior leadership in ops on all elements related to enhancements, upgrades and chances to the business technology platform.
Supports other projects and other areas as needed on projects that span across own business unit.
Performs other related duties as required or requested.
Upholds the Crawford Code of Business Conduct at all times.
Participates in special projects or performs duties in other areas as requested.